Just saw the official reveal of the 2026 Freelander and I have to say, Land Rover is making a bold move going full electric with this one. This isn’t just a regular SUV conversion – they’re positioning it as a serious off-road contender with genuine capabilities.
The design looks genuinely impressive. They’ve kept the iconic Freelander DNA but given it a modern, muscular stance. The electric powertrain gives them some interesting advantages – instant torque for tricky terrain, lower center of gravity for better handling, and that whisper-quiet operation could actually be beneficial in wilderness areas.
What caught my attention:
– Dual motor setup for proper 4WD capability
– Impressive ground clearance and approach angles
– Battery capacity supposedly around 110 kWh for decent range
– Fast charging capability for those remote adventures
– Redesigned interior with sustainable materials
The rugged exterior design really appeals to the classic Freelander heritage. They’ve added underbody protection, roof rails, and all the practical touches you’d expect. The price point hasn’t been fully revealed yet, but expectations are it’ll be competitive with other premium electric SUVs.
